I feel as Chrisy does about the terminology. I started seeing a naturopathic physician 10 years ago and still see him every 5-6 weeks. I take supplements guided by my naturopath and my own research and am I very careful about my nutrition. My naturopath also does acupuncture and a kind of acupressure. At first I didn't tell my other doctors I was seeing him, but now they are on board with the idea and even have collaborated with him on some testing. I believe I probably would not have survived as long as I have without complementary medicine that kept my body strong during conventional treatments and surgeries.
